Gujarat Titans (GT) were completely outplayed by the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) in the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2026 Qualifier 1 at the Himachal Pradesh Cricket Association Stadium on Tuesday, May 27.

RCB amassed 254/5 in 20 overs after being invited to bat first by GT skipper Shubman Gill. Ravichandran Ashwin opined that Gill missed a trick by not bringing Rashid Khan into the attack right after the end of the power play.

"Rashid Khan has not had a very good season. The entire IPL 2026 hasn't been one of the greatest seasons for spinners, but for Rashid Khan, it has probably been one of the better seasons than some of the other spinners. I personally think Shubman missed a trick by not bringing in Rashid for the seventh over," Ashwin said in his recent YouTube video.

While Ashwin mentioned that not bringing Rashid into the attack was the wrong move from Gill, he said that the 26-year-old has been one of the best captains this season. The former India off-spinner also lauded Gill for changing his batting approach.

"Shubman Gill has been one of the better captains in this IPL, if not one of the best. And the way he has changed his batting, I will take my hat off. But their team has some weaknesses and flaws. They have covered it by utilizing the home advantage," he added.

"I don't understand why they played Kulwant Khejroliya today" - R Ashwin on GT's playing XI

Ashwin said that playing Kulwant Khejroliya in the high-voltage fixture was a mistake, and the 28 runs that the left-arm pacer conceded in the 15th over changed the game in favour of RCB.

"RCB exposed GT's limitations at a neutral ground. It was an important toss to win, and he chose to field first. But I don't understand why they played Kulwant Khejroliya today. I don't understand. If you want to play someone, there needs to be some mystery. He is not a mystery spinner or bowler; he has already played a few matches. 28 runs were scored in the 15th over, and it completely turned the game," Ashwin said.
